    Hi, Salut
    you should use JTable's DataModel to update your table.
    data[row][column] = currentLineTokens.nextToken();
    jTableInfo.getModel().setValueAt(data[row][column], row, column);
    jTableInfo.repaint();BEWARE CSV files and StringTokenizer, i've had problems with it (for example ;;Test; is not tokenized "", "", "Test")
    StringTokenizer ignores separator when in first position, and ignores double separators. I use this piece of code before tokenize a String :
    private static char _separator = ';';
    private static String checkCsvString(String s) {
             * V�rification du s�parateur inital, perdu par le StringTokenizer et
             * pourtant bien important
            if (s.startsWith("" + _separator)) {
                s = " " + s;
             * V�rification des doubles s�parateurs, perdus par le StringTokenizer
            int index;
            while ((index = s.indexOf("" + _separator + _separator)) >= 0) {
                s = s.substring(0, index) + _separator + " " + _separator + s.substring(index + 2);
            return s;
        }hope it helps

  • LabVIEW for ARM 2009 Read from text file bug

    Hello,
    If you use the read from text file vi for reading text files from a sdcard there is a bug when you select the option "read lines"
    you cannot select how many lines you want to read, it always reads the whole file, which cause a memory fault if you read big files!
    I fixed this in the code (but the software doesn't recognize a EOF anymore..) in CCGByteStreamFileSupport.c
    at row 709 the memory is allocated but it tries to allocate to much (since u only want to read lines).
    looking at the codes it looks like it supposed to allocated 256 for a string:
    Boolean bReadEntireLine = (linemode && (cnt == 0)); 
    if(bReadEntireLine && !cnt) {
      cnt = BUFINCR;    //BUFINCR=256
    but cnt is never false since if you select read lines this is the size of the file!
    the variable linemode is also the size of the file.. STRANGE!
    my solution:
    Boolean bReadEntireLine = (linemode && (cnt > 0));  // ==
     if(bReadEntireLine) {    //if(bReadEntireLine && !cnt) {
      cnt = BUFINCR;
    and now the read line option does work, and reads one line until he sees CR or LF or if the count of 256 is done.
    maybe the code is good but the data link of the vi's to the variables may be not, (cnt and linemode are the size of the file!)
    count should be the number of lines, like chars in char mode.
    linemode should be 0 or 1.
    Hope someone can fix this in the new version!
